It's actually quite difficult to write even a stub on regular wiki about behavior mod places, because one of wiki's standards is that all material must be unbiased.

It's not impossible, it's just that since almost all of the accounts are anecdotal at this point, who is to say which story is "right"? (from wiki's standpoint, that is.) Most of us are a bit passionate about this sort of thing, so to sift that away from the factual data can be hard, without editorializing it, especially since we know we're way fucking right.

Yes, in some way it will be better, but the program owners reads wikipedia too and it ends up in a revert war. I lost one in febuary and my wikipedia account is watched by one or two people living in St. George according to Wiki-scanner.

But you are not watched and the syntax on Fornits Wiki are the same as on Wikipedia. It is very easy to copy a page from Fornits Wiki to the real Wikipedia. Just remember to alter the categories. They have a category called "behavior modification" which is a nice fit.
